Wave propagation in a viscoelastic line carrying a liquid in turbulent flow

Résumé

Small amplitude axisymmetric sinusoidal waves in an orthotropic, viscoelastic, rough pipe carrying a compressible liquid in turbulent flow are considered. The wall behaviour is described after Kuiken (1984) and the turbulent flow is described by means of an eddy viscosity profile model. We use a four-region model presented by Ohmi & Usui (1976), slightly modified in order to take into account the wall roughness. A one-dimensional dispersion equation is derived, which can predict the two lowest modes of propagation for waves of low frequency. The effects of Reynolds number, pipe roughness or wall viscoelasticity on phase velocity and attenuation factor are presented.
